The Antares type was a modular,[1] extremely versatile design, and could be used for transporting cargo,[2] conducting scientific research,[3] and more.

Antares type class vessels

U.S.S. Antares NCC-501  • S.S. Woden  • U.S.S. Yorkshire NCC-330  • NCC-502  • NCC-G1465  • Unnamed robot grain ship
